It is estimated that eight medium pizzas are about right to

serve a physics club meeting of 32 students. How many pizzas
would be required if the group, due to a conflicting math club
meeting, was only going to have 20 students in attendance?

Final answer:

If there are only 20 students in attendance, 5 pizzas would be required.

Step-by-step explanation:

In order to determine how many pizzas would be required if there are only 20 students in attendance, we can set up a proportion using the information given:



8 medium pizzas / 32 students = x pizzas / 20 students



To solve for x, we can cross-multiply:



8 * 20 = 32 * x



160 = 32 * x



Dividing both sides by 32, we get:



x = 160 / 32 = 5



Therefore, 5 pizzas would be required if there are only 20 students in attendance.
